Global Software and IT takes a unique approach that works for projects of any size, examining such critical topics as:
- Executing a seamless project across multiple locations
- Mitigating the risks of off-shoring
- Developing and implementing processes for global development
- Establishing practical outsourcing guidelines
- Fostering effective collaboration and communication across continents and culture
This book provides a balanced framework for planning global development, covering topics such as managing people in distributed sites and managing a project across locations. It delivers a comprehensive business model that is beneficial to anyone looking for the most cost-effective, efficient way to engineer good software products.
